Can I do MBBS after B.Sc nursing?


Sir, I am a student of B.Sc nursing in 1st year. I want to know can I do MBBS after the B.Sc nursing. If no, then what we should do after the B.Sc nursing? What is the scope for that field? Please reply me on my email id. [email protected]

Yes, you can pursue MBBS after completing B.Sc nursing. You have to appear for NEET entrance examination in order to pursue MBBS. As you are pursuing B.Sc nursing which is a 4 years course, so you will again waste five and half years to complete MBBS.

Inspite of doing MBBS you can opt for M.Sc nursing course. after completing this course you can become a nurse in private or government hospitals. You can also get employed in different public sectors where nurses are required and also in Indian Army.

You can very much get admission in MBBS course after completion of your B.Sc(Nursing) course, there is no such problem in it. You will only have to appear for AIPMT examination and after can get admission in MBBS if you clear the minimum cut-off required for admission in the prospective Institute.
